I recently upgraded a machine I own from 2K->XP pro. I already had SPTD installed (with Daemon tools) under 2k, but it failed to work once upgraded. I tried to uninstall and reinstall and got the infamous "Failed to oped config key" error.
In any event, in this half-installed mode, SPTD caused serious USB problems for me. iTunes couldn't detect my iPod, camera software failed to see my digital camera, and my USB flash drive no longer worked. In essence, anything that would mount as a drive via USB no longer worked. XP still detected the device, loaded the appopriate drivers, and so on. It seemed that only the drive-like functionality was gone. USB devices like a USB->serial converter, USB printers, USB hubs, and so on continued to work unaffected.
I tried reinstalling the appropriate software & drivers for these different devices which did not fix the the problem. Also, all these devices worked post-upgrade, so the upgrade itself was not the issue.
Eventually, I remembered the problems with SPTD, and disabled it via the FAQ registry fix. (setting the key to 4, see below)
See FAQ (http://www.duplexsecure.com/en/faq) for details. 2nd question on the list.
Note that I'm sure doing the safe-mode uninstall and reinstall would probably fix the USB issues as well, but I wanted to make sure these particular symptoms were identified, and at least a temporary fix was identified as working.
